What does "native" mean?
-
noun Someone who was born in a particular place.
"As a native of New Orleans, she knew all the best spots for gumbo."
-
adj Belonging to a place by birth or original origin, rather than having moved there or been introduced.
"The oak is native to much of Europe and North America."
-
adj Present or built into something from the start, rather than added on later — often used of skills or abilities.
"She has a native talent for languages that she never had to work hard at."
